云服务器的网络带宽为 2M(即2Mbps)是否够用,取决于你的具体使用场景。下面是一些常见场景的分析和建议:
一、2Mbps 带宽的基本概念
- 2Mbps = 256 KB/s(理论下载速度)
- 实际上传/下载速度会受到网络延迟、服务器性能、并发连接数等因素影响。
二、适用场景分析
| 使用场景 | 是否适合 | 说明 |
|---|---|---|
| 静态网站展示(HTML/CSS/JS) | ✅基本可用 | 小型企业官网、个人博客等页面不大、访问量不高的网站可以勉强使用。 |
| 图片较多的网页或电商站 | ❌不够用 | 图片加载慢,用户体验差,尤其是多用户同时访问时容易卡顿。 |
| 视频流媒体服务 | ❌严重不足 | 视频播放需要更高带宽,2Mbps连高清视频都难以流畅播放。 |
| API 接口服务(低并发) | ✅可能够用 | 如果是轻量级 API,响应数据小,访问量不高,可以使用。 |
| 后台管理系统(内网访问) | ✅够用 | 如果只是内部系统使用,且访问人数少,2Mbps 足够。 |
| 远程登录管理(SSH、RDP) | ✅够用 | 命令行操作或图形桌面远程控制对带宽要求不高。 |
| 数据库同步(小规模) | ✅够用 | 数据量不大、频率较低的同步任务可以使用。 |
三、考虑因素
-
访问量大小
- 如果每天只有几十到几百个访问者,2Mbps 可能勉强应付;
- 若访问量大或有突发流量(如促销、活动),带宽将明显不足。
-
内容类型
- 纯文本、小图片:可接受;
- 大图、视频、文件下载:严重不足。
-
并发用户数
- 单个用户平均占用带宽约 100KB/s(即 0.8Mbps);
- 2Mbps 最多支持约 2~3 个用户同时进行中等访问。
-
CDN 提速
- 如果你使用 CDN 来缓存静态资源,服务器本身的带宽需求会降低,2Mbps 也能应对较大流量。
四、建议
- 开发测试环境 / 低访问量项目:2Mbps 是可以接受的。
- 生产环境 / 公众访问类网站 / 高并发服务:建议至少 5Mbps ~ 10Mbps 起步,并根据实际负载弹性调整。
- 如果预算有限:可以选择按流量计费的云服务器,避免带宽浪费。
五、如何监控和优化带宽使用?
- 使用工具如
iftop、nload、Netdata监控实时带宽; - 启用 Gzip 压缩、图片懒加载、浏览器缓存等优化手段;
- 使用 CDN 分发静态资源,减少服务器直接传输压力;
- 对于高并发应用,使用负载均衡 + 弹性扩容方案。
总结
2Mbps 带宽对于轻量级用途是可以接受的,但对于大多数面向公众的 Web 应用来说偏低。
如果你的应用有一定访问量或者对用户体验有要求,建议选择更高带宽配置,或者使用 CDN 来弥补带宽限制。
如你能提供更具体的使用场景(比如做什么网站、预计多少人访问、是否有图片/视频等),我可以帮你更精确评估是否足够。
ECLOUD博客